Output 93fecb31ab4f25dd59aea16176d6c2e46ee0bf2a7d5f9b9a68ba6c0800ca6e98:5

value
20582749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3e0735f9ba39e5930a4a25156b9f1341f98ef66 OP_EQUAL
address
MW8fK9jmXGDD5izGm7boNThuV2pn1AwL9s
transaction
93fecb31ab4f25dd59aea16176d6c2e46ee0bf2a7d5f9b9a68ba6c0800ca6e98
spent
true